Dr Mainie works as a Consultant Gastroenterologist in the Ulster Independent Clinic. He also works as a Consultant Gastroenterologist in the Belfast Trust. Dr Mainie qualified from Queens University Belfast in 1995. He trained in both Gastroenterology and General Medicine. Dr Mainie completed an advanced therapeutic endoscopy and oesophageal motility fellowship in Medical University South Carolina, Charleston, SC, USA 2003 -2006. He also completed his MD in Reflux disease and Impedance-pH testing in Medical University South Carolina.

Dr Mainie provides a tertiary referral service for upper GI patients including complex reflux patients, early oesophageal and stomach cancers, oesophageal motility disorders, endoscopic Ultrasound for cancer staging and therapeutic interventional endoscopy. He provides a regional service for endotherapy (including endomucosal resection and radiofrequency ablation) for Barrett's oesophagus.

Dr Mainie recently represented N Ireland as a regional expert as part of an international group for quality endotherapy for Barrett's oesophagus. He also does General Gastroenterology including the treatment of inflammatory bowel disease and irritable bowel syndrome. Dr Mainie does over 1200 upper and lower endoscopies a year.

He is very active in both national and international research and regularly reviews for international journals. He was the principal Investigator on the SPIT study, BOSS study, HALO registry, DELTA project in the use of cytosponge for Gastroesophageal reflux disease disease and Barrett's oesophagus and also the Hemopspray registry. Recently completed research in the International HALT study for upper GI bleeding. Principal Investigator for Eosinophilic Oesophagitis research trial into biologics. Starting a new national study into AI in endoscopy. He has over 60 publications and over 115 abstracts to date. He attends European Gastroenterology meetings regularly as well as the British Society of Gastroenterology meeting. He is a member of the Oesophageal Stomach Cancer -NI for patients He is a core member on the oesophageal section committee of the British Society of Gastroenterology, current secretary. He is actively involved in teaching both local, national and international. Dr Mainie is an Honorary Lecturer for Queens University Belfast.
